#031d50 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#031d50 is composed of 1.2% red, 11.4%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.3% cyan, 63.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 219.7 degrees, a saturation of 92.8% and a lightness of 16.3%. #031d50 color hex could be obtained by blending #063aa0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#031d50
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000204 is the darkest color, while #f0f5fe is the lightest one.
